The Philippines Strengthens Travel Ties to China

Published

on

The Tourism Promotions Board (TPB) Philippines successfully concluded the Philippine China Travel Exchange (PHILCHITEX) held from June 24 to 27. The event reinforced partnerships with tourism stakeholders and restored Chinese travel confidence in the Philippines, building on the country’s 14-day visa-free program.

The event brought together 30 Chinese delegates and Philippine sellers for a business-to-business networking session in Parañaque City, creating new opportunities for collaboration and business growth.

The Chinese buyers then connected with regional sellers and explored the country’s diverse tourism offerings in Boracay and Cebu through immersive familiarization tours.
